纯棉织物的稀土-柠檬酸配合物染色

【摘要】 将稀土-柠檬酸配合物应用于纯棉织物活性染色中,讨论了染色工艺和稀土-柠檬酸配合物、元明粉、代用碱用量对染色效果的影响。结果表明,稀土-柠檬酸配合物具有明显的促染作用,染色深度可提高15%~20%,并减少30%元明粉用量;使用代用碱SA-RCF固色,可提高稀土-柠檬酸配合物在染色中的稳定性,上染率和固色率大幅提高。与常规染色织物相比,稀土-柠檬酸配合物活性染料染色织物的匀染性略差,除钇-柠檬酸配合物外,色差变化不明显,耐摩擦色牢度和耐皂洗色牢度基本一致,耐光色牢度略有提高。

【Abstract】 Rare earth-citric acid complexes are applied to reactive dyeing of cotton fabric.The influences of dyeing process and dosages of rare earth-citric acid complexes,sodium sulphate and substitute alkali on dyeing results are discussed.The results show that rare earth-citric acid complexes have obvious accelerating action in reactive dyeing,and fixation with substitute alkali SA-RCF can improve the stability of rare earth-citric acid complexes.Dyeing with rare earth-citric acid complexes,the color depth increases by 15%-20%,the dye uptake and fixation improves significantly,and the dosage of sodium sulphate reduces by 30%.Compared with traditional reactive dyeings,the dyeings with rare earth-citric acid complexes feature a little reduced evenness,no obvious color deviation except Yttrium-citric acid complexes,almost the same color fastness to rubbing and soaping,and slightly enhanced color fastness to light.
